Micro Puff Hoody, from the brand Patagonia, is a highly compressible synthetic down jacket.
It combines an ultralight Pertex® Quantum outer fabric with PlumaFill insulation. It offers the best weight-to-warmth ratio of all Patagonia jackets.
It is the essential insulating jacket for facing the cold and mixed conditions (or even truly harsh ones).
The outer fabric is made of 100% post-consumer recycled NetPlus® ripstop nylon manufactured from recycled fishing nets, and the insulation is made of 100% recycled polyester.
Main features
- Ultralight and windproof Pertex® Quantum outer fabric in 100% post-consumer recycled NetPlus® ripstop nylon made from recycled fishing nets to reduce plastic pollution in the oceans; with PFC-free (no perfluorinated chemical compounds) durable water repellent (DWR) finish.
- Revolutionary PlumaFill insulation offering groundbreaking lightness and featuring the same structure as down insulation with a uniform synthetic material that provides the warmth and compressibility of down, even when wet.
- Innovative quilting that enhances insulation by maintaining and maximizing the loft of PlumaFill fibers with a minimum of seams.
- Front zip with storm flap and chin guard for added comfort at the chin; fit designed for freedom of movement, compatible with wearing a harness or backpack.
- Two zippered and welted hand warmer pockets; left pocket also doubles as a stuff sack and features a reinforced carabiner clip; two interior drop-in pockets.
- Simple, lightweight hood that sits comfortably under a helmet.
- Elastic cuffs and adjustable hem to retain warmth.
- This style is Fair Trade Certified™ sewn, which means the workers who made it received a premium for their labor.
